Diary of a Mad Old Man
Diary of a Mad Old Man, directed by Wayne Wang, is a provocative and unflinching exploration of desire, power, and the complexities of aging. As an ailing patriarch becomes consumed by an increasingly obsessive fixation, the boundaries between control and vulnerability begin to erode, exposing the fragile tensions within his family and himself.
Starring Brian Cox and Fan Bingbing, and produced by Eleonora Granata-Jenkinson, the film is a darkly intimate character study—one that confronts the uncomfortable truths of longing, dignity, and the unsettling persistence of desire.
